Homestay (also known as local lodging or staying with locals) is a form of welcoming and accommodation (arranging resting places, dining areas) for tourists in a budget-friendly manner. In this type of lodging, local residents share their living space with travelers in the area where the tourists are visiting and wish to stop for rest. The duration of stay can vary from one night to over a year and can be provided free of charge (gift economy), in exchange for compensation, or in exchange for lodging through the guests’ assets.

This budget-style lodging (Homestay) is an example of cooperative spending and the sharing economy. Staying with locals offers several advantages compared to other forms of accommodation, such as allowing tourists to experience daily life in a different place, creating opportunities to live like locals and experience local culture and traditions, cultural diplomacy, friendships, and improving language skills through everyday communication.

COMMON TYPES OF HOMESTAY IN VIETNAM

  • Garden homestay in rural areas: These homestays are often located in rural areas, surrounded by beautiful natural landscapes such as mountains and lush green fields. Tourists choose rural homestays to enjoy the tranquility of nature, participate in outdoor activities like hiking, farming, and engaging in local cultural studies.
  • Coastal and island homestay: These homestays are usually located in coastal destinations and islands, providing opportunities for tourists to relax on the beach, participate in water sports, and enjoy beautiful sea views.
  • City homestay: For travelers who want to explore urban life, city homestays in urban areas offer convenient options and often provide better value than hotels. Tourists can experience urban life, explore nearby attractions, and enjoy the benefits of a central location.
  • Cultural experience homestay: Cultural homestays offer tourists the opportunity to live with local families, participate in daily life, and explore local culture through cooking traditional dishes, learning the local language, or participating in festivals and cultural studies.
  • Historical experience homestay: Some homestays are set up in historical buildings such as old villas, castles, or traditional houses. Staying in these places allows tourists to experience the charm and history of a bygone era while still enjoying modern amenities.

THE RISKS OF DIY HOMESTAY DESIGN WITHOUT AN ARCHITECT

Here are 5 common risks of not hiring an architect to design your homestay:

  • Unprofessional design: A lack of in-depth knowledge can lead to designs that do not meet functional, aesthetic, technical, and safety requirements.
  • Lack of uniqueness: DIY designs may result in ordinary outcomes that do not stand out in a competitive market.
  • Budget overruns: A lack of knowledge and planning can lead to wasted resources and budget, causing unnecessary additional costs.
  • Regulatory violations: Unprofessional designs may lead to violations of construction and safety regulations, resulting in legal issues.
  • Inefficiency in construction and maintenance: Non-optimized designs can create difficulties in the construction and maintenance of the homestay later on.

FACTORS TO CONSIDER WHEN CREATING A HOMESTAY TO LEAD THE VIETNAMESE MARKET

  • Create a unique experience: A homestay needs to have a unique or outstanding element to attract customers. This could be in interior design, a unique location, or a distinctive travel experience you offer to guests.
  • Excellent customer service: Create outstanding customer service to make a strong impression on customers. Quick feedback, meeting special requests, and ensuring comfort and satisfaction for guests are essential.
  • Interior design and space: Design the interior and space of the homestay to be comfortable, aesthetic, and effective. Use colors, decorations, and spatial design to create a cozy and relaxing atmosphere.
  • Amenities and conveniences: Ensure that the homestay is fully equipped with necessary amenities such as beds, bathrooms,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and other conveniences. This ensures comfort and convenience for guests.
  • Effective management and marketing: Manage the homestay effectively by building a rental schedule, tracking finances, and managing staff (if any). Additionally, implement a strong marketing strategy to promote the homestay and attract new customers.

WORKING PROCESS WHEN DESIGNING HOMESTAY IN VIETNAM

We would like to introduce the company’s 3-phase, 12-step design process to you. 

Pre-design phase: 

1. Information gathering.

2. Consulting on the work process, advising on suitable design package quotes.

3. Signing the contract, surveying, measuring.

Concept design phase: 

4. Analyzing the current situation

– The land (current status, traffic, viewpoints, spatial orientation).

– Climate (lighting, sun direction, wind direction, water surface).

– Analyzing greenery.

– Analyzing architecture (layout, shapes, materials).

5. Concept design (Proposing functions and design styles suitable for the investor’s needs).

6. Floor plan proposal.

7. 3D architectural part, 3D interior part (if included), 3D garden part (if included).

Technical implementation phase: 

8. Construction permit drawings (if included)

9. Detailed implementation drawings:

– Architectural part, detailed interior part (if included), detailed garden part (if included)

– Structural part.

– Electrical and plumbing part.

10. Perspective drawings adjusted according to the technical design documents (updating actual construction materials)

11. The lead architect checks the entire file before issuing the construction documents

12. Printing and handing over the documents
